First, work through this problem the conventional nonfuzzy way, writing matlab commands that spell out linear and piecewiselinear relations. Fuzzy logic examples using matlab consider a very simple example. Fuzzy logic, fuzzy logic controller flc and temperature control system. So, less water will heat up quicker which means less energy consumption. Nowadays, fuzzy, in japanese 77yd has become something like a quality seal. The applications range from consumer products such as. An introduction to fuzzy logic for practical applications. Above and below are examples of carlies other work as a signwriter. There are many other examples of this, with the help of which we can understand the concept of fuzzy logic. It is employed to handle the concept of partial truth, where the truth value may range between completely true and completely false. In recent years, the number and variety of applications of fuzzy logic have increased significantly. Fuzzy logic is used with neural networks as it mimics how a person would make decisions, only much faster. Mar 22, 2016 fuzzy logic with engineering applications by timothy j ross without a doubt. In this version of the fuzzy logic sample application we will take a more detailed look at how these sets and rules are used in practice.
Chapter 16 treats two application areas of fuzzy logic. Fuzzy logic introduction by martin hellmann, march 2001 1. Fuzzy logic with engineering applications by timothy j ross without a doubt. Solutions to the problems are programmed using matlab 6. Section 3 application of fuzzy logic discusses the potential application of fuzzy logic to risk management. Functions are provided for many common methods, including fuzzy clustering and adaptive neurofuzzy learning. You can implement your fuzzy inference system in simulink using fuzzy logic controller blocks water level control in a tank.
This video introduces fuzzy logic, including the basics of fuzzy. Some examples temperature controller motor speed control system 21. This site is like a library, use search box in the widget to get ebook that you want. He is the founding coeditorinchief of the international journal of intelligent and fuzzy systems, the coeditor of fuzzy logic and control. Implement a water level controller using the fuzzy logic controller block in simulink. Fuzzy logic, unlike probability, handles imperfection in the informational content of the. In fuzzy logic toolbox software, fuzzy logic should be interpreted as fl, that is, fuzzy logic in its wide sense.
The tutorial is prepared based on the studies 2 and 1. In fact, this chapter also contains the answer for one of the open prob. A read is counted each time someone views a publication summary such as the title, abstract, and list of authors, clicks on a figure, or views or downloads the fulltext. Fuzzy logic toolbox provides matlab functions, apps, and a simulink block for analyzing, designing, and simulating systems based on fuzzy logic. Formal fuzzy logic 7 fuzzy logic can be seen as an extension of ordinary logic, where the main difference is that we use fuzzy sets for the membership of a variable we can have fuzzy propositional logic and fuzzy predicate logic fuzzy logic can have many advantages over ordinary logic in areas like artificial intelligence where a simple truefalse statement is. Introduction low cost temperature control using fuzzy logic system block diagram shown in the fig. Synthesis of the hardwaresoftware interface in microcontrollerbased systems. Their recommendations, patience and handson approach to problem solving have been exceptional. If you continue browsing the site, you agree to the use of cookies on this website.
Sep 23, 2009 fuzzy logic is taken under consideration one of those multivalued logic derived from fuzzy set thought to handle reasoning it quite is approximate particularly than precise. Almost all the consumer products have fuzzy control. Here, each element of x is mapped to a value between 0 and 1. We envision, sometime in the future, a curriculum in fuzzy sys tems theory, which. Fuzzy logic, ebook, elearning, multimedia software. Fuzzy set theory and fuzzy logic establish the specifics of the nonlinear mapping. When i first came across fuzzy logic, i found it strikingly similar to probability. In other words, we can say that fuzzy logic is not a logic that is fuzzy, but the logic that is used to describe fuzzy.
The number which indicates value in fuzzy systems is called true value. Fuzzy logic fuzzy logic software fuzzy logic package fuzzy logic library fuzzy logic sourceforge open source gnu gpl lgpl java windows linux osx fcl iec 11 iec 611 iec 611 part 7 iec 6117 fuzzy logic wikipedia. Fuzzy logic and expert systems applications, volume 6 1st edition. To illustrate the value of fuzzy logic, examine both linear and fuzzy approaches to the following problem. Chapter 17 discusses some of the latest applications using neural networks and fuzzy logic. Basically, fuzzy logic fl is a multivalued logic, that allows intermediate. In this edition, page numbers are just like the physical edition. The fundamentals of fuzzy logic are discussed in detail, and illustrated with various solved examples. The basic ideas underlying fl are explained in foundations of fuzzy logic. Example of fuzzy logic controller using mamdani approach part 1 duration. Introduction to fuzzy logic, by f ranck dernoncourt home page email page 19 of 20 several activation functions for the output lay er are commonly used, such as linear, logistic or softmax.
Some of the examples include controlling your room temperature with the help of airconditioner, antibraking system used in vehicles, control on traffic lights, washing machines, large economic systems, etc. In addition, applications of fuzzy logic are presented to provide readers with a complete understanding of related concepts. Difference between fuzzy set and crisp set in hindi with examples in details. Fuzzy logic fuzzy logic differs from classical logic in that statements are no longer black or white, true or false, on or off. The publication takes a look at fuzzy associative memory, fuzzy sets as hypercube points, and disk files and descriptions, including fuzzy thought amplifier, fuzzy decision maker, and composing and creating a memory. We can mark the light off as false, and light on as true. We then look at how fuzzy rule systems work and how they can be made adaptive. Formal fuzzy logic 7 fuzzy logic can be seen as an extension of ordinary logic, where the main difference is that we use fuzzy sets for the membership of a variable we can have fuzzy propositional logic and fuzzy predicate logic fuzzy logic can have many advantages over ordinary logic in areas like.
Based on your location, we recommend that you select. Application of fuzzy logic sl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. The book also deals with applications of fuzzy logic, to help readers more fully understand the concepts involved. This video quickly describes fuzzy logic and its uses for assignment 1 of dr. Motivation fuzzy logic was introduced in the mid1960s as a discipline which changed the concepts of conventional logic. The product guides you through the steps of designing fuzzy inference systems.
First few chapters are lengthy and theoretical but i think they set the right mindset to understand the subject in depth. An introduction to fuzzy logic and fuzzy sets james j. This is a very small tutorial that touches upon the very basic concepts of fuzzy logic. Fuzzy logic in control systems fuzzy logic provides a more efficient and resourceful way to solve control systems. Fuzzy logic and gis 5 wolfgang kainz university of vienna, austria 1. Welcome guys, we will see what is fuzzy logic in artificial intelligence in hindi with examples. Introduction to fuzzy logic using matlab basic principles of fuzzy logic are discussed in detail, including a variety of solved examples. Suppose that is some universal set, an element of, some property. For you, the water is warm and for your friend, the water is cold. Fuzzy logic is applied with great success in various control application. Dec, 2005 these fuzzy numbers are then stored in a fuzzy set that i said previously allows us to process the information the set contains using an almost english way of thinking about it called rules. This would be simple system that has two states and is described with george booles logic.
In other words, we can say that membership function represents the degree of truth in fuzzy logic. Choose a web site to get translated content where available and see local events and offers. This tutorial paper provides a guided tour through those aspects of fuzzy sets and fuzzy logic that are necessary. Introduction to fuzzy logic, by franck dernoncourt home page email page 2 of20 a tip at the end of a meal in a restaurant, depending on the quality of service and the quality of the food. Artificial intelligence fuzzy logic systems tutorialspoint. Since its inception in 1965 it has grown from an obscure mathematical idea to a technique used in a wide variety of applications from cooking rice to controlling diesel engines on an ocean liner. The book offers an unconventional introductory textbook on fuzzy logic, presenting theory together with examples and not always following the typical mathematical style of. The concept of fuzzy sets is one of the most fundamental and influential tools in computational intelligence. Fuzzy logic has become an important tool for a number of different applications ranging from the control of engineering systems to artificial intelligence. We then briefly look at hard and software for fuzzy logic applications. We approached fuzzy logic about designing a more scalable, secure and performant infrastructure for our growing business. When autoplay is enabled, a suggested video will automatically. It can be implemented in systems with various sizes and capabilities ranging from small microcontrollers to large, networked, workstationbased control systems.
Purchase fuzzy logic and expert systems applications, volume 6 1st edition. It has been, and still is, especially popular in japan, where logic has been introduced into all types of consumer products with great determination. Section 4 risk assessment framework based on fuzzy logic discusses using a. Does anyone have any suggestions for a good book on fuzzy logic. Read fuzzy logic in intelligent system design theory and applications by available from rakuten kobo. Fuzzy logic pdf download download ebook pdf, epub, tuebl. This tutorial will be useful for graduates, postgraduates, and research students who either have an. Fuzzy logic are used in natural language processing and various intensive applications in artificial intelligence. Oct 23, 2009 fuzzy logic is often heralded as a technique for handling problems with large amounts of vagueness or uncertainty. Software and hardware applications, and the coeditor of fuzzy logic and probability applications. Lm35 temperature sensor sense the current temperature. When a set point is defined, if for some reason, the motor runs faster, we need to slow it down by reducing the input voltage. Boolean logic, and the latter 2 is suitable for a fuzzy controller using fuzzy logic.
Zadeh, professor for computer science at the university of california in berkeley. Figure 114 rule consequences in the heating system example. Fuzzy logic resembles the human decisionmaking methodology and deals with vague and imprecise information. In fuzzy logic, the truth value of a variable or the label in a classification problem is a real number between 0 and 1. To understand fuzzy logic, let us take a very simple example. It quantifies the degree of membership of the element in x to the fuzzy set a. This chapter also expands on fuzzy relations and fuzzy set theory with several examples. The geometric visualization of fuzzy logic will give us a hint as to the possible connection with neural.
This interface consists of the sequential logic that physically connects the devices to the microcontroller and. If the motor slows below the set point, the input voltage must be. Applying fuzzy logic to risk assessment and decisionmaking. Certain threshold for rate of variation has to be taken, which may not be true for other images or noisy images. Nov 25, 2011 this video introduces fuzzy logic, including the basics of fuzzy sets, fuzzy rules and how these are combined in decision making. In this chapter we discuss some open problems related to fuzzy implications, which have either been completely solved or those for which partial answers are known. The fuzzy logic works on the levels of possibilities of input to achieve the definite output. Section 2 fuzzy logic and fuzzy set theory introduces the theoretical background of the fuzzy logic model and compares it to other models. Pdf synthesis of the hardwaresoftware interface in. In traditional logic an object takes on a value of either zero or one.
This book bridges the gap that has developed between theory and practice. Moreover, it makes them familiar with fuzzy control, an important topic in the engineering field. In the illustrative fuzzy logic that we consider in this section, fuzzy statements have the form. What is fuzzy logic controller and its applications examples. This article is a brief introduction to the subject of fuzzy computing through demonstration of a few of the core principles using a fuzzy controller. Fuzzy set theoryand its applications, fourth edition.
Fuzzy sets, fuzzy logic, fuzzy methods with applications. For example, suppose you are in a pool with a friend. A usual subset of set which elements satisfy the properties, is defined as a set of ordered pairs where is the characteristic function, i. It is called membership value or degree of membership. For each step in the decision process, the sensor uses fuzzy logic to do the thinking. Our aim here is not to give implementation details of the latter, but to use the example to explain the underlying fuzzy logic.
Fuzzy logic presents a different approach to these problems. Introduction to fuzzy sets, fuzzy logic, and fuzzy control systems. Boolean logic often fails to adequately simulate realworld conditions because things are never simply just black and white or zeroes and ones but exist in millions of shades of grey. Fuzzy sets can provide solutions to a broad range of problems of control, pattern classification, reasoning, planning, and computer vision. Fuzzy logic are extensively used in modern control systems such as expert systems. Fuzzy boom universities as well as industries got interested in developing the new ideas first, this was mainly the case in japan. It shows that in fuzzy systems, the values are denoted by a 0 to 1 number.
Even in the present time some greeks are still outstanding examples for fussiness and fuzziness, note. We already know that fuzzy logic is not logic that is fuzzy but logic that is used to describe fuzziness. Bottom line, since fuzzy logic joined the team, i sleep much better at night. A mathematical logic that attempts to solve problems by assigning values to an imprecise spectrum of data in order to arrive at the most accurate conclusion possible. Fuzzy ifthen rules statements used to formulate the conditional statements that comprise fuzzy logic example. In this concise introduction, the author presents a succinct guide to the basic ideas of fuzzy logic, fuzzy sets, fuzzy relations, and fuzzy reasoning, and shows how they may be applied. Say, for example, if we have to define the probability of appearance of an edge in few frames of images, we have to define, what is an edge. What might be added is that the basic concept underlying fl is that of a linguistic variable, that is, a variable whose values are words rather than numbers. Click download or read online button to get fuzzy logic pdf download book now. It is the responsibility of the user to select a function that is a best representation for the fuzzy concept to be modeled. Lotfi zadeh, the father of fuzzy logic, claimed that many vhwv in the world that surrounds us are defined by a nondistinct boundary. Fifty years of fuzzy logic and its applications studies in fuzziness. A short fuzzy logic tutorial april 8, 2010 the purpose of this tutorial is to give a brief information about fuzzy logic systems. For further information on fuzzy logic, the reader is directed to these studies.
One simply associates a real number between 0 and 1 inclusive to a statement, instead of an event. The text is a valuable source of data for researchers interested in fuzzy logic. A membership function for a fuzzy set a on the universe of discourse x is defined as. Fuzzy logic is a form of manyvalued logic in which the truth values of variables may be any real number between 0 and 1 both inclusive.
Since then, the term fuzzy logic has come to mean mathematical or computational reasoning that utilizes fuzzy sets. In fuzzy logic, a statement can assume any real value between 0 and 1, representing the degree to which an element belongs to a given set. This fuzziness is best characterized by its membership function. Applications of fuzzy set theory 9 9 fuzzy logic and approximate reasoning 141 9. An introduction to fuzzy logic applications in intelligent systems. Fuzzy logic and its application in technical systems. Fuzzy logic in artificial intelligence with example. A fuzzy set theory corresponds to fuzzy logic and the semantic of fuzzy operators can be understood using a geometric model.
From its introduction, many publications have being appearing to explain its main theoretical concepts and applications. Similar books to fifty years of fuzzy logic and its applications studies in. Advanced fuzzy logic technologies in industrial applications. Indeed, thevhw ri kljk prxqwdlqv,or,the vhw ri orz ohyho phdvxuhphqwv in fig 1 are examples of such sets. Jan 03, 2017 he determined that the binary codes 0 and 1 represented extremes, but he could use fuzzy logic algorithms to identify those inbetween areas.
1050 878 1081 451 1586 1495 622 1264 760 309 808 562 1147 1014 1293 291 630 907 1433 1347 862 1165 1100 529 956 1329 1154 258 1470 637 759 507 439 771